🌞 What Is a Residential Solar System?
A residential solar system converts sunlight into electricity using solar panels installed on rooftops. This energy is used to power home appliances such as lights, fans, ACs, and refrigerators. A residential solar system for homes is reliable, eco-friendly, and designed for long-term savings.

🔌 Types of Residential Solar System
On-Grid Residential Solar System
Connected to the electricity grid and ideal for homes with stable power supply.
Off-Grid Residential Solar System
Includes battery backup and works during power cuts.
Hybrid Residential Solar System
Combines grid connectivity with battery storage for maximum efficiency.
